#9cbbc0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9cbbc0 is composed of 61.2% red, 73.3% green and 75.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.8% cyan, 2.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 188.3 degrees, a saturation of 22.2% and a lightness of 68.2%. #9cbbc0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#397781.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

#9cbbc0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9cbbc0 has RGB values of R:156, G:187, B:192 and CMYK values of C:0.19, M:0.03, Y:0,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 10271680.
